Sources Center for International Health Information (CIHI). Estimates were compiled from the World Health Organization (WHO) and the United Nations Childrens Fund (UNICEF).

Definition Vaccination coverage rate for DPT-3 is the proportion of surviving infants who received three doses of DPT (diphtheria, pertussis and tetanus) vaccine before their first birthday. Diphtheria is an acute inf ectious disease caused by toxigenic strains of corynebacterium diphtheriae, acquired by contact with an infected person or a carrier of the disease, which is usually confined to the upper respiratory tract. It is characterized by the formation of a tough pseudomembrane attached firmly to the underlying tissue that will bleed if forcibly removed. Tetanus is a painful and usually fatal disease, resulting generally from a wound, and having as its principal symptom persistent spasm of the voluntary m uscles. Pertussis is an acute, highly contagious infection of the respiratory tract, most frequently affecting young children, Symptoms include fever, conjunctivitis and a characteristic cough. Coughing spells end in a whoop caused by the forceful inspiration of air.

Notes Regional averages are weighted by the population under one year of age. Note that regional averages are higher in years for which there are no data for Haiti. DPT is a four-dose schedule (the first dose is considered &qu ot;0") for children resulting in lifelong immunity to diphtheria, pertussis and tetanus. As the third dose signifies the completion of the series, this dose is used to estimate coverage rates. The estimate of vaccination coverage rates is used to m easure the ability of a country to provide universal child immunization. The World Summit goal for immunization is the maintenance of 90 percent coverage among children under 1 year of age.
